The Evolution of Healthcare: From Clinics to Clicks
A Brief History of Telemedicine
Telemedicine, an online doctor service, originated in the 1960s. It had been used to treat astronauts and provide healthcare to rural communities but was not widely applied today because of the advancement in technology. Currently, service providers like Doctor online Ireland have made it possible to ensure that quality healthcare could be accessed by anyone, provided they have an Internet connection.
Why Ireland Fell in Love with Online Healthcare
Ireland's healthcare system is not an exception. There have been challenges in the health sector due to the COVID-19 pandemic. It had reached a point when the hospitals were overwhelmed and people were turning to online consultation as a safe and efficient alternative. This saved the pressure on the conventional health systems and also presented practicality of telemedicine as a staple in the post-pandemic world.
Benefits of Choosing Doctor Online Ireland Services
1. Convenience and Accessibility
The waiting hours in crowded clinics are now a thing of the past. Online doctor platforms make it possible to book consultations at your convenience, sometimes in minutes. This is quite helpful for people who stay in remote areas, miles away from healthcare facilities.
Real-life example: Anna, a resident of Dublin, was able to consult a GP about her seasonal allergies via an online platform during her lunch break, saving her a half-day leave from work.
2. Cost-Effectiveness
Traditional in-person consultations often involve travel expenses and time off work. Online doctor services typically cost less while offering the same level of professional care. Additionally, many Irish online doctor platforms accept health insurance, further reducing out-of-pocket costs.
3. Privacy and Comfort
Discussing personal health issues can be daunting. Online consultations provide a discreet setting, allowing patients to communicate freely from the comfort of their homes.
4. 24/7 Availability
Health concerns don’t adhere to a 9-to-5 schedule. Many online doctor platforms in Ireland operate 24/7, ensuring help is always at hand.
How Doctor Online Ireland Platforms Work
Step 1: Registration and Profile Setup
Users sign up, enter fundamental health information, and select their favorite doctor.
Step 2: Scheduling an appointment
Appointments are available on the website, allowing users to select video, audio, or text appointments.
Step 3: Consultation and Prescription
Doctors will review symptoms during the session and prescribe remedies and, if required, will write prescriptions that can be forwarded to a local drugstore or have them brought to your residence.
Step 4: Follow-Up
Many portals include additional consultation visits to track progress or continued issues.

Criticism: What are the Drawbacks?
The pros are obvious; however, Doctor online Ireland services aren't without challenges:
Complicated Diagnoses: There are conditions, for example, fracture or infections that need to be evaluated through physical examination, not possible through an online doctor consultation.
Digital Divide: Not all residents in Ireland have the same access to high-speed internet or digital literacy. This will therefore limit how far-reaching the services may be.
Privacy Issues: Even though online platforms implement robust encryption, some patients are still reluctant to expose their health information online.
To curb this, the online platforms have to continuously innovate and strictly observe data protection regulations.
The Future of Doctor Online Ireland Services
Industry Trends
AI and Chatbots: Automated tools will streamline patient queries and be used to triage.
Wearable Integration: It will be possible to wear devices like smartwatches which can transmit real-time health data to doctors for improvement in diagnostic accuracy.
Mental Health Services: Virtual platforms are expanding to include therapy and counseling, addressing the growing demand for mental health support.
Potential Innovations
Virtual Reality (VR) for immersive consultations.
Blockchain for enhanced data security.
Language Translation for inclusivity in multilingual communities.
